Caley road, Tunbridge wells, TN2 3BN

Caley road is a street located in Tunbridge wells, with a postcode of TN2 3BN. There have been 8 property transactions in this postcode since 1995, with 6 unique properties. The most common property type in this street is semi. The most recent sale was on Wednesday, 17 July 2024 at 54 Caley road which sold for £325000. The average broadband download speed is 187.60 mbps. There are 5 nearby train stations, 10 nearby bus stops and 10 nearby schools. TN2 3BN postcode was first in introduced in January 1980. TN2 3BN is located within the Tunbridge Wells Travel To Work Area. NHS Services in this postcode are provided by the West Kent Primary Care Trust. The 2011 Census Output Area for this postcode is classified as 'Hard-pressed living, Migration and churn, Hard-pressed ethnic mix'. TN2 3BN has an Index of Multiple Deprivation of 5503.

Deprivation Index

The Index of Multiple Deprivation (IMD) is a UK measure that ranks areas based on multiple indicators of deprivation such as income, employment, health, education, housing, crime, and access to services. The IMD informs decisions and helps allocate resources to reduce poverty and improve life chances.
